MySQL是一款领先的开源关系型数据库管理系统,它在多种场景下都表现出色。以下是一些MySQL表现优秀的具体场景:
1. Web应用程序
MySQL是Web应用程序的首选数据库系统之一,特别是与PHP、Python、Java等后端技术结合使用时。它能够高效地处理网站数据,如用户信息、页面内容和交易记录,同时支持大量并发连接,适应高流量访问。许多流行的Web框架和CMS(内容管理系统),如WordPress、Drupal、Joomla、Laravel、Django等,都支持MySQL作为其后端数据库。
2. 企业级应用程序
许多企业级应用程序需要一个持久的、高性能的数据存储介质来存储和处理数据,MySQL成为了企业级应用程序的首选数据库之一。这些应用可能包括客户关系管理系统(CRM)、企业资源规划系统(ERP)、库存管理系统、供应链管理(SCM)、人力资源管理(HRM)和商业智能(BI)系统等。MySQL提供了可靠的性能和安全性,能够满足企业对数据安全、完整性和性能的要求。
3. 移动应用程序
许多移动应用程序需要在本地存储和处理数据,以便在没有互联网连接的情况下进行操作。MySQL可以轻松地与移动应用程序结合使用,通过REST API或其他技术,移动应用可以与MySQL数据库进行交互,实现用户认证、数据存储和检索等功能。MySQL的跨平台支持和对移动设备友好的接口使其成为移动应用开发中的理想选择。
4. 在线游戏
随着在线游戏的受欢迎程度越来越高,需要一个快速、可靠的数据库来存储游戏数据。MySQL对高并发环境的支持使其成为理想选择,它可用于存储玩家信息、游戏状态、排行榜数据等。许多在线游戏和多人游戏都依赖于MySQL来管理其数据。
5. 金融应用程序
金融应用程序需要高度安全、可靠的数据存储和处理解决方案。MySQL提供了强大的安全功能,包括SSL、AES和SHA1等加密算法,确保了金融数据的安全性和一致性。银行、证券公司和保险公司等金融机构都广泛使用MySQL来管理其交易记录、客户信息和财务数据。
6. 数据仓库系统
虽然MySQL本身不是为大数据分析设计的,但它可以作为数据仓库的一部分,用于存储和预处理数据,然后将其导入到专门的大数据分析工具中。MySQL通过数据水平拆分等技术,提供高效的数据存储和处理解决方案。
7. 物联网(IoT)应用
在物联网应用中,MySQL可以用于存储从各种传感器收集的数据。这些数据可以用于实时监控、历史分析和决策支持。智能家居系统、工业物联网平台和智能城市项目等都广泛使用MySQL来管理其数据。
8. 嵌入式系统
嵌入式环境对软件系统最大的限制是硬件资源非常有限,MySQL的轻量级版本适用于这些环境。MySQL具有轻量级和可配置性高的特点,使其适用于嵌入式系统,如网络设备、家用电器和车载系统等。它可以在资源受限的环境中运行,为设备提供必要的数据管理能力。
9. 教育和研究领域
MySQL也广泛应用于教育和研究领域,用于存储和管理实验数据、学生信息、课程内容等。
10. 政府和公共部门
政府和公共部门机构也使用MySQL来存储和管理公民信息、公共服务数据、统计数据等。
综上所述,MySQL在多种场景下都表现出色,这得益于其强大的功能、灵活性和可靠性。无论是Web应用程序、企业级应用程序、移动应用程序还是在线游戏等领域,MySQL都能为开发者提供强大的数据管理和查询功能。
759

被折叠的 条评论
为什么被折叠?



